Here's how you make your place look awesome (and friendly for women while still keeping your nerd things):
Key things to notice:
(- Hide your nerd things in cabinets.)
- I've set an interior design theme (modern corporate)
- I've set a colour theme (white, grey, and black with splashes of bright colours accented everywhere)
- Everything here outside the electronics and the couch/chairs is cheap Ikea furniture. You can get great looking furniture for cheap, would definitely recommend. The David Eames Lounge chair, Barcelona chairs, Aeron chair, and Couch were expensive though but you can find cheaper alternatives. I guess the bar stools were slightly expensive at $250 each.
- I hide my cables through the walls, between baseboard and floor, and use zap straps and sticky zap strap hooks that I place behind furniture to run the wires+strap through.
- Carpets are ugly. Consider getting rid of them if you own.
- Put up art wherever you can. I used cheap prints, some even video game based, but nothing most people would recognize as from a video game. Gotta keep it classy.
